So in place of "DYN (Shared object file)" which isn't completely true, show "DYN (Position Independent Executable file)". It requires a little bit of untangling code in readelf due to process_program_headers setting up dynamic_addr and dynamic_size, needed to scan .dynamic for the DT_FLAGS_1 entry, and process_program_headers itself wanting to display the file type in some cases. At first I modified process_program_header using a "probe" parameter similar to get_section_headers in order to inhibit output, but decided it was cleaner to separate out locate_dynamic_sections instead. It looks like the toolchain doesn't have too many places that require tweaking due to the change in readelf. Hopefully this won't break other package builds.
